陶瓷模石膏粉是我國重要的石膏產(chǎn)品躁绸。隨著國民經(jīng)濟(jì)的快速發(fā)展,日用陶瓷和衛(wèi)生潔具市場逐漸擴(kuò)大臣嚣,陶瓷模具石膏粉的需求量越來越大净刮,質(zhì)量也越來越高。陶瓷模因其生產(chǎn)工藝硅则、使用方法和制模方式不同淹父,性能不同,對陶瓷模石膏粉的性能要求也不同怎虫。
Ceramic mold gypsum powder is an important gypsum product in China. With the rapid development of national economy, the market of household ceramics and sanitary ware is gradually expanding, the demand of ceramic mold gypsum powder is increasing, and the quality is also increasing. Due to the different production process, use method and mold making method, the performance of ceramic mold is different, and the performance requirements of ceramic mold gypsum powder are also different.
